Overview of the VQ35 Engine



Established as component of Nissan's VQ engine family, the VQ35 engine is a 3.5-liter V6 powerplant that has amassed a track record for its balance of efficiency and effectiveness. Presented in the early 2000s, this engine has actually been employed in numerous Nissan and Infiniti designs, consisting of the Murano, Altima, and 350Z. Its style integrates an aluminum alloy block and DOHC (Twin Overhead Camshaft) setup, which contribute to its portable and lightweight nature.


The VQ35 engine features a 60-degree V-angle and makes use of variable valve timing modern technology, enhancing both power distribution and gas effectiveness. With an optimal output commonly around 280 horsepower and 270 lb-ft of torque, it supplies adequate efficiency for a mid-sized SUV. The engine is additionally known for its smooth operation and reasonably low noise degrees, making it ideal for family-oriented automobiles like the Murano.

Typical Concerns



While the VQ35 engine is celebrated for its total Reliability, it is not without its share of common concerns that owners may experience. One constant worry involves the engine's oil usage. Several VQ35 proprietors report excessive oil burning, which can cause low oil levels and prospective engine damage if not resolved quickly.


One more why not try this out problem relates to the timing chain. vq35. The VQ35 is outfitted with a timing chain instead than a belt, which typically needs much less maintenance, some proprietors have actually experienced chain stretch and associated rattling noises, specifically in older designs. This can cause extreme engine damages otherwise diagnosed early


Furthermore, the engine might endure from coolant leakages, particularly at the intake manifold. Such leakages can bring about overheating and succeeding engine failure if not taken care of.


Lastly, the mass air flow sensor (MAF) can stop working, triggering efficiency issues such as rough idling and a decline in fuel effectiveness. vq35.
